Advertisement

LDPC编码与解码的实现

  •  5星
  •     浏览量: 0
  •     大小:None
  •      文件类型:None


简介:
《LDPC编码与解码的实现》一书专注于低密度奇偶校验(LDPC)码的技术细节,深入探讨了其高效编码和译码算法的设计与应用。 使用MATLAB仿真实现LDPC编解码,并进行BPSK调制以测定误码率与信噪比之间的关系。

全部评论 (0)

还没有任何评论哟~
客服
客服
  • LDPC
    优质
    《LDPC编码与解码的实现》一书专注于低密度奇偶校验(LDPC)码的技术细节,深入探讨了其高效编码和译码算法的设计与应用。 使用MATLAB仿真实现LDPC编解码,并进行BPSK调制以测定误码率与信噪比之间的关系。
  • LDPCFPGA(Verilog+MATLAB)
    优质
    本项目探讨了使用Verilog和MATLAB在FPGA上实现低密度奇偶校验(LDPC)编码及解码技术的过程,展示了高效的硬件设计方法。 FPGA Verilog硬件实现的LDPC编码解码资源包含Verilog源代码及MATLAB仿真程序,欢迎下载使用。
  • LDPCMATLAB
    优质
    本项目致力于在MATLAB环境中开发和优化低密度奇偶校验(LDPC)编码与译码算法。通过详细设计及仿真,验证其纠错性能,并提供高效可靠的通信系统解决方案。 基于MATLAB实现LDPC码的编解码及性能分析。
  • MatlabC语言LDPC终止代-LDPC
    优质
    本项目提供了基于MATLAB和C语言实现的低密度奇偶校验(LDPC)编码及其解码终止算法的完整源代码,旨在研究通信系统中的纠错技术。 该存储库提供了LDPC码的C语言与MATLAB实现版本。有关LDPC代码的相关概述可以参考TomTomson和RüdigerUrbanke的书籍。 具体来说,这里提供的内容包括: - WiFi(IEEE802.11n)中LDPC编码的设计方法; - 通过反向替代编码技术来构造WiFi LDPC码; - 迭代置信传播(BP)解码算法的应用(包含最小和运算); - 在加性高斯白噪声(AWGN)信道下,BPSK、4-QAM、8-QAM(等效于QPSK、16-QAM以及64-QAM)的模拟实验。 需要注意的是,所提供的代码可能并不完全符合IEEE 802.11n规范的要求。例如,并未实现诸如打孔、填充和流解析等功能特性。 性能评估方面: - 在AWGN信道中不同速率与调制方式下的LDPC码性能表现如上图所示。 - 上述结果基于LdpcC代码,且测试次数为50K次运行。 关于程序的执行效率比较,在单个macbookpro2015设备上的对比情况如下: | 参数 | C语言版本(每秒迭代次数) | MATLAB版本(每秒迭代次数) | 速度提升倍数 | | --- | --- | --- | --- | | N=648,比率=1/2 | 315.5K次/s | 0.079次/s | 约3986倍 | | N=1296,比率=1/2 | 73.1K次/s | 22.8次/s | 约3.2倍 | | N=1944,比率=1/2 | 50.0K次/s | 17.5次/s | 约2.86倍 | 以上数据表明,在处理速度方面C语言版本明显优于MATLAB版本。
  • LDPC
    优质
    LDPC编码与解码技术是一种高效的错误修正编码方法,在通信系统中用于提高数据传输的可靠性及效率。 可以在MATLAB平台上实现BPSK调制AWGN信道LDPC编译码的误码率性能仿真。
  • 基于MATLABLDPC仿真
    优质
    本研究利用MATLAB平台,实现了低密度奇偶校验(LDPC)码的高效编码和解码过程,并进行了详细的仿真测试。 基于MATLAB的低密度奇偶校验(LDPC)码编码与解码仿真探讨了LDPC码的基本原理、源程序设计以及性能评估中的仿真图展示。文中详细分析了在MATLAB环境下,不同参数设置对LDPC码性能的影响,包括但不限于:代码长度、列权重和迭代次数等关键因素的调整及其效果。通过具体实验验证这些变化如何影响编码与解码过程,并展示了相应的源程序及结果图形以供进一步研究参考。
  • Verilog和MATLAB下LDPCFPGA
    优质
    本项目探讨了在Verilog和MATLAB环境下LDPC(低密度奇偶校验)码的FPGA实现技术,包括编码与解码过程,并比较了两种方法的有效性及性能。 FPGA Verilog硬件实现的LDPC编码解码资源包括Verilog源代码以及MATLAB仿真源程序,欢迎下载使用。谢谢!
  • 基于MATLABLDPC算法LDPC性能评估.zip
    优质
    本资源提供了一种在MATLAB环境下实现低密度奇偶校验(LDPC)编码及译码的方法,并对LDPC码在不同信道条件下的通信性能进行了详尽测试和分析。 在进行MATLAB开发过程中,会涉及到算法的设计与实现、系统代码的编写以及相关设计文档和使用说明书的撰写等工作内容,这些成果可以作为参考材料使用。
  • VerilogLDPC
    优质
    本项目采用Verilog硬件描述语言实现了低密度奇偶校验(LDPC)码的编码算法,适用于通信系统中高效率、高性能的数据传输需求。 LDPC编码通过结合H校验矩阵使用,并基于FPGA硬件实现编码功能。
  • LDPCVerilog
    优质
    本项目提供低密度奇偶校验(LDPC)码的Verilog硬件描述语言实现代码,适用于通信系统中高效错误检测与纠正。 LDPC编码Verilog代码指的是用于实现低密度奇偶校验(Low-Density Parity-Check, LDPC)码的硬件描述语言(Verilog)编写的具体程序或模块。这类代码通常应用于通信系统中,以提高数据传输的可靠性与效率。 如果需要进一步详细说明或者示例,请明确指出具体需求或是应用场景。